When it comes to selecting a mini heat pump for your pool, potential buyers often feel overwhelmed by the plethora of options available. Choosing the right vendor is crucial, as it can significantly impact the efficiency, durability, and overall performance of the heat pump. Here are four essential tips to help you make the best selection for your pool heat pump vendor.

1. Assess the Vendor's Reputation.

Before making a decision, research the vendor's standing in the industry. Look for online reviews and testimonials from satisfied and dissatisfied customers alike. Platforms such as Google, Yelp, and dedicated pool forums can provide critical insights. Personally, I found that reading various reviews helped me gauge a vendor’s reliability and the quality of their products. A vendor with a strong reputation will likely offer better customer service and support after the sale.

2. Compare Product Specifications.

Once you've shortlisted potential vendors, take the time to compare the specifications of the mini heat pumps they offer. Important features to examine include heating capacity (measured in BTUs), energy efficiency ratings (COP and SEER), and unit size. Tailoring your selection based on your pool's size and your local climate is key. I found that choosing a heat pump with the right specifications enabled my pool to maintain a comfortable temperature throughout the swimming season effectively.

3. Evaluate Customer Support and Warranty.

Don't underestimate the importance of customer support when selecting a mini heat pump vendor. Ensure that the vendor offers extensive assistance, including installation guides, troubleshooting materials, and technical help. A generous warranty indicates the manufacturer’s confidence in their product. Look for vendors that provide warranties ranging from 2 to 5 years, as this level of assurance contributes to peace of mind with your investment.

4. Check for Installation Services.

Some vendors offer installation services, while others may require hiring a third-party contractor. If you're not handy with installations, opt for a vendor that provides professional services. An experienced installer will ensure the unit is set up properly, enhancing its efficiency and lifespan. Additionally, some vendors may offer ongoing maintenance and support, making your investment more manageable over time.
